I really hope we get to meet Razah again! And I think it would tie in well with the Revenant. What does everyone else think about that? For those who don’t know about “him,” Razah was an entity formed in the mists, who’s base class was Ritualist, and was an optional hero we could obtain in GW1. I will post his description at the very bottom.

The way I see it, introducing him could actually be pretty…Revenant relevant! Not to mention it would be another awesome throwback to GW1 (a lot of the Revenant is already a throwback to GW1, and we’re getting other cool stuff like GW1 dinosaurs). Who better to teach Rytlock how to wield the mists, than a creature spawned from and of the mists itself? He would also have some ties to Ogden (for one, they are both hundreds of years old and would’ve known each other since they both traveled with us, the player character). It would be cool to get the two of them together. And Razah would prove to be a valuable ally I’m sure. I was always fascinated with him.

Just to be clear, I am NOT suggesting we be able to use him as some kind of Revenant skill. I want him to be a character we get to meet and interact with. I don’t think it would make sense to be able to channel him as a skill because well…I don’t think he’d have died between GW1 and GW2.

http://wiki.guildwars.com/wiki/Razah

“The protomatter that makes up the Mists strains toward creation, often spawning demonic creations in nightmarish forms. Not all creatures from the Mists are demonic, however. When the Mists come into contact with a suitable human template, for example, it can copy that form, creating a sentient entity with humanoid appearance and an almost human mind.

Razah is one such creation. It has sprung into being a fully-formed adult. It has the knowledge and capabilities of a human, but lacks common sense. As a result, it asks odd questions about human emotions, contemplates human motivations, and attempts to duplicate human mannerisms. Razah is a contradiction: more than human in some ways, and less than human in others. It needs an identity, a personality, and a purpose. Hopefully, it will find its purpose by working with a hero. Otherwise, it could degenerate into an abomination as monstrous and inhuman as its demonic brethren.

— The Guild Wars Nightfall Manuscripts"

New Concept for HoT: Guild Alliances

in Guild Wars 2: Heart of Thorns

Posted by: Gandalf.3516

Gandalf.3516

Sure, you could all join each other’s guilds (at least, up to 5 guilds) but that isn’t even REMOTELY the same thing and doesn’t function well for an “alliance,” I wouldn’t call that an alliance at all.

One major thing you just said is alliance chat, which a lot of people miss. Alliance chat lets tons of people from, let’s say 5-10 guilds, all talk at once. It has a lot of benefits. Also you can easily go into each other’s guild halls. I’d say those two things alone make it MORE than worthwhile. It’s something that GW1 offered and has been very much missed. It allows for easier communication, and more interaction with other guilds that are similar to your own. And if you don’t like alliance chat? Turn it off, problem solved.

On top of that there’s plenty of other things they could add. They could add special alliance missions, or allow all guilds in an alliance to do guild missions together without having to join the other people’s guilds. They could add various things you can build that are specifically related to alliances and maybe each guild in the alliance has to contribute a certain amount to build it (alliance bank perhaps). They could allow for “trading” of influence points. Like if the other guild is short a few thousand for something, or it’s a pretty new and/or small guild, then you could give guilds in your alliance some of your own influence points. There’s a lot they can do to make it fun and useful.

[sugestion] Griffon pets for rangers

in Guild Wars 2: Heart of Thorns

Posted by: Gandalf.3516

Gandalf.3516

Griffons would be very cool. There’s a lot of cool ranger pets they could add really, things already in the game that we can’t actually tame. Drakes, basilisks, bats, dolphins, dolyak, fleshreavers, fish, crabs, triops, sea scorpions, griffons, pinipals, insects, minotaurs, oozes, thorn wolves, raptors, sea turtles, skale, skelk, wind riders.

The risen chicken Twitchy shows that we can liberate elder dragon minions. That could present some cool ranger pets. Branded, risen, destroyers, icebrood…minions of every dragon really.

I think they also missed an opportunity with the living story, and the maps that come with it. Wouldn’t it be cool if we could get some special twisted pet? Or a little karka pet? How about a giant spotted beetle? Build your own steam creature, anyone?
